The Hidden Economics of Front Axle Maintenance
When evaluating the total cost of ownership for a modern 4x4, the front axle is frequently the most neglected assembly. While rear differentials and transfer cases often get scheduled maintenance, the front truck differential operates in a harsh environment, subjected to water fording, extreme articulation, and the constant rotational drag of front axle disconnect systems. In 2026, with the widespread adoption of complex Independent Front Suspension (IFS) designs and advanced axle disconnect actuators, front differential fluid service is no longer optional; it is a critical financial safeguard against catastrophic drivetrain failure.
Unlike solid front axles of the past, modern IFS differentials feature smaller fluid sumps, tighter bearing tolerances, and aluminum housings that dissipate heat rapidly but run hotter under sustained 4WD loads. A neglected front differential will exhibit pinion bearing whine, ring gear pitting, and eventual actuator seizure. 2026 Pricing Matrix: Where Does Your Money Go?
The cost of a front truck differential service varies wildly depending on where you hand over your keys. In 2026, the average dealership labor rate has climbed to between $165 and $195 per hour, while independent 4x4 specialty shops average $130 to $155 per hour. Because a front differential fluid drain and fill typically books at 0.5 to 0.8 hours of labor, the service is relatively quick, but the markup on OEM-branded synthetic gear oil remains steep.
| Service Provider | Avg. Labor Rate (2026) | Front Diff Service Cost | Front/Rear/T-Case Bundle | Warranty Impact |
|---|---|---|---|---|
| OEM Dealership | $165 - $195 / hr | $140 - $210 | $350 - $480 | Maintains factory powertrain warranty |
| Independent 4x4 Shop | $130 - $155 / hr | $110 - $160 | $280 - $390 | Valid if documented per Magnuson-Moss Act |
| Quick Lube Chain | $110 - $130 / hr | $85 - $120 | $220 - $300 | High risk of incorrect fluid/spec usage |
| DIY (Home Garage) | N/A | $45 - $85 | $130 - $220 | Valid if you keep receipts and logs |
Fluid Chemistry and the API GL-5 Standard
Before analyzing specific vehicle costs, it is vital to understand what you are paying for. Modern front truck differentials require API GL-5 certified synthetic gear oils, typically in 75W-85 or 75W-140 viscosities. According to AMSOIL Technical Guides, GL-5 fluids contain high levels of sulfur-phosphorus extreme pressure (EP) additives. These additives are designed to sacrificially coat hypoid gear teeth, preventing metal-on-metal contact under the extreme sliding friction inherent to ring and pinion gearsets.
In 2026, premium synthetic gear oils utilizing polyalphaolefin (PAO) base stocks cost between $22 and $35 per quart. While budget mineral-based 80W-90 fluids can be found for under $10 a quart, using them in a modern IFS front differential will lead to rapid fluid shearing, thermal breakdown, and voided warranty claims. Always verify the OEM specification, such as Ford's WSL-M2C192-A or GM's Dexron Ultra V, before purchasing fluid.
Vehicle-Specific Cost & Capacity Breakdown
The exact cost of your service is heavily dictated by your truck's specific axle architecture, fluid capacity, and hardware requirements. Below is a technical breakdown for the three most common 4x4 platforms on the road today.
Ford F-150 & Super Duty (M210 / Dana 44 IFS)
- Fluid Capacity: 1.73 quarts (1.64 Liters)
- OEM Fluid Spec: Motorcraft SAE 75W-85 Premium Synthetic (Part # XL-14)
- Hardware Torque Specs: Fill and Drain plugs require 33 lb-ft. Note: Many aluminum IFS housings use a 3/8-inch drive square plug rather than a hex bolt.
- Estimated DIY Cost: $55 (Two quarts of premium synthetic + new crush washers)
Ram 2500/3500 (AAM 9.25 IFS)
- Fluid Capacity: 2.4 quarts (2.27 Liters)
- OEM Fluid Spec: Mopar 75W-85 Synthetic Axle Lubricant
- Hardware Torque Specs: 25 lb-ft for both fill and drain plugs. Over-torquing the aluminum housing plugs is a common failure point leading to stripped threads.
- Estimated DIY Cost: $75 (Three quarts required, as 2.4 qts necessitates buying three)
Chevy Silverado / GMC Sierra 1500 (GM 9.25 IFS)
- Fluid Capacity: 1.9 quarts (1.8 Liters)
- OEM Fluid Spec: ACDelco Dexron Ultra V 75W-85
- Hardware Torque Specs: 24 lb-ft. GM utilizes a unique threaded plug with an integrated O-ring seal; reusing the old O-ring often leads to slow weeping.
- Estimated DIY Cost: $60
Decoding the Dealership Invoice: Hidden Fees
When you opt for professional service, the base labor and fluid costs are only part of the equation. In 2026, service writers frequently pad drivetrain maintenance invoices with ancillary fees. Understanding these line items allows you to audit your bill and negotiate unnecessary charges.
- Shop Supplies / Hazmat Fee ($15 - $28): A standardized percentage added to cover rags, brake cleaner, and fluid disposal. This is often non-negotiable at corporate dealerships but can be contested at independent shops.
- Axle Breather Tube Inspection ($45 - $85): Some dealers charge a separate 0.3-hour labor line item to 'inspect and clear' the front axle breather hose. While crucial for preventing water ingestion, this should be included in the standard drain-and-fill procedure.
- Fluid Extraction Surcharge ($30): If your truck lacks a traditional drain plug (common on some older or specialized solid axles), shops use a pneumatic vacuum extractor. Most modern IFS truck differentials have dedicated drain plugs, making this fee illegitimate.
The DIY Advantage: Procedure and Pitfalls
Performing a front truck differential fluid service at home remains the most cost-effective strategy, often saving the owner $100 to $150 per service interval. However, the margin for error in modern IFS systems is razor-thin. According to maintenance archives at Car and Driver, the most common DIY mistake is filling the differential to the brim rather than to the precise level of the fill plug.
Expert Warning: Never use a fluid that contains friction modifiers designed for Limited Slip Differentials (LSD) in an open front IFS differential unless explicitly mandated by the OEM. Friction modifiers can degrade the elastomer seals inside front axle disconnect actuators, leading to $800+ actuator replacement bills.
To execute the service correctly, the truck must be perfectly level. You must always remove the fill plug before the drain plug. If the fill plug is seized or stripped—a common issue in regions that use road salt—you will be left with an empty differential and no way to refill it, necessitating a tow to a shop. Always use a dedicated 3/8-inch drive torque wrench set to the manufacturer's exact specification (typically 24 to 33 lb-ft) when reinstalling plugs to prevent cracking the cast aluminum housing.
Conclusion: Protecting Your Drivetrain Investment
The front truck differential is a marvel of modern engineering, but it is entirely dependent on the thin film of synthetic gear oil protecting its hypoid gears and needle bearings. In 2026, with replacement front axle assemblies exceeding $3,500 to $5,000 installed, the $150 dealership service or $60 DIY fluid swap is an undeniable bargain. Whether you choose to pay a certified technician or turn the wrenches yourself, adhering to strict OEM fluid specifications and torque data is the only way to ensure your 4x4 system engages flawlessly when the pavement ends.
